Output 4c4baa51866abed33b6ee08cb7b5836d2ac4d6c7a23d49b112c875c30dc5fab4:1

value
136164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bcf507d02653df92517d678b35b5b7a38ad26c OP_EQUAL
address
3FhufsE8aF56rFw1hWaTHauFETJMDt5qAV
transaction
4c4baa51866abed33b6ee08cb7b5836d2ac4d6c7a23d49b112c875c30dc5fab4
spent
true